dns解析异常导致无法上网时,应依次执行:一、手动设置首选dns为8.8.8.8和114.114.114.114;二、管理员运行cmd执行flushdns、ip reset、winsock reset并重启;三、禁用ipv6;四、登录路由器修正dns设置并重启。

如果您电脑已成功连接WiFi但无法访问互联网,且系统提示DNS解析异常,则可能是由于DNS服务器地址配置错误或不可达导致域名无法转换为IP地址。以下是解决此问题的步骤:
一、手动设置首选DNS服务器
通过将DNS服务器地址更改为稳定可靠的公共DNS,可绕过本地ISP提供的可能故障的DNS服务,从而恢复域名解析能力。
1、右键点击任务栏右下角网络图标,选择“打开网络和Internet设置”。
2、点击“更改适配器选项”,在列表中右键当前连接的WiFi名称,选择“属性”。
3、双击“Internet协议版本4(TCP/IPv4)”。
4、勾选“使用下面的DNS服务器地址”,在“首选DNS服务器”栏输入8.8.8.8,在“备用DNS服务器”栏输入114.114.114.114。
5、点击“确定”保存设置,关闭所有窗口。
二、刷新DNS缓存并重置网络协议栈
本地DNS缓存中若存在错误或过期记录,会导致解析失败;同时TCP/IP协议栈异常也可能干扰DNS通信,需同步清理与重置。
1、以管理员身份运行命令提示符:在开始菜单搜索“cmd”,右键选择“以管理员身份运行”。
2、依次执行以下命令,每输入一行后按回车:
ipconfig /flushdns
netsh interface ip reset
netsh winsock reset
3、执行完毕后重启电脑使重置生效。
三、禁用IPv6协议避免冲突
部分路由器或网络环境对IPv6支持不完善,启用IPv6可能导致系统优先尝试不可用的IPv6 DNS路径,进而引发解析超时或失败。
1、进入“网络连接”界面,右键当前WiFi连接,选择“属性”。
2、在列表中取消勾选“Internet协议版本6(TCP/IPv6)”。
3、点击“确定”保存,无需重启,立即生效。
四、检查路由器DNS转发设置
若路由器自身设置了错误的上游DNS或启用了DNS劫持功能,所有接入设备均会继承该异常配置,需登录路由器后台修正。
1、在浏览器地址栏输入路由器管理地址(常见为192.168.1.1或192.168.0.1),使用管理员账号登录。
2、进入“DHCP服务器”或“LAN设置”页面,查找“DNS服务器”相关选项。
3、将“DNS服务器地址”设为留空,或手动填入8.8.8.8与114.114.114.114。
4、保存设置并重启路由器。










